How can I spice up my tacos?

My favorite seasonings and spices to add into taco meat are chili powder, cayenne pepper, red pepper flakes, paprika, and other things that add a bit of spice. You can also cook meat along with onions, garlic, peppers, tomato sauce, etc. to get those flavors mixed into the taco meat.

What is the best steak to use for tacos?

To make the steak tacos: Use flank steak. It is a lean cut of beef and is best when cooked to medium rare and thinly sliced, making it perfect for tacos.

Do you cut steak before or after cooking?

A steak is not a bag of juices, nothing significant will leak off of it. It’s indeed better to cut in a smaller piece that fits your pan, the whole steak should touch the bottom of the pan otherwise you might have uneven cooking / raw ends. TL;DR: Yes, it’s fine to cut meats before cooking.

What do you put on steak?

When seasoning a steak, you can’t go wrong with the classic freshly cracked black pepper and kosher salt. Finishing salts such as flaky sea salt and can be applied at the end as a final touch. Add some chopped herbs such as thyme, rosemary or sage to your salt to make a flavored salt for your steak.

Why is my skirt steak so tough?

Skirt steak is shaped much the same, but tends to have a beefier flavor. But, this cut comes from the diaphragm muscles of the animal, making it a tougher piece of meat. It can become very chewy quickly, especially if it’s not cooked correctly. They love marinade and high-heat, quick cooking.

How do you make skirt steak more tender?

Let chilled meat sit for about 20-30 minutes at room temperature before cooking. COOK SKIRT STEAK WITH COARSE SALT: Although a marinade or rub can be used to enhance the flavor and make the meat more tender, coarse salt is always the best option.
